Trilokpur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Trilokpur Village has a population of 1.07 k (1,068) with 560 (560) males and 508 (508) females.The sex ratio in Trilokpur is 908,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Trilokpur Village is 143 (143) which is 13.39% of Trilokpur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Trilokpur Village is 555 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Trilokpur village is listed as part of the Sultanpur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Sultanpur District in the state of UTTAR PRADESH in INDIA.

Trilokpur Literacy Rate
Trilokpur Village has a literacy rate of 72.76%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Trilokpur Village is 85.9 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Trilokpur Village is 59.3 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Trilokpur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Trilokpur Village is 245 (245) with 133 (133) males and 112 (112) females, which is 22.94% of Trilokpur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 843 females for every 1000 males.
Trilokpur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es Population in Trilokpur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Trilokpur Village.

Trilokpur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Trilokpur Village, there are about 258 (258) workers, making up nearly 24.16% of the Trilokpur Village total population. Out of these, around 234 (234) are male workers, and about 24 (24) are female workers.
